42 PCI read and write operation.
44 @param PeiServices An indirect pointer to the PEI Services Table
45 published by the PEI Foundation.
46 @param This Pointer to local data for the interface.
47 @param Width The width of the access. Enumerated in bytes.
48 @param Address The physical address of the access.
49 @param Buffer A pointer to the buffer of data.
51 @retval EFI_SUCCESS The function completed successfully.
52 @retval EFI_NOT_YET_AVAILABLE The service has not been installed.

66 PCI read-modify-write operation.
68 @param PeiServices An indirect pointer to the PEI Services Table
69 published by the PEI Foundation.
70 @param This Pointer to local data for the interface.
71 @param Width The width of the access. Enumerated in bytes.
72 @param Address The physical address of the access.
73 @param SetBits Value of the bits to set.
74 @param ClearBits Value of the bits to clear.
76 @retval EFI_SUCCESS The function completed successfully.

91 The EFI_PEI_PCI_CFG_PPI interfaces are used to abstract accesses to PCI
92 controllers behind a PCI root bridge controller.
95 PCI read services. See the Read() function description.
98 PCI write services. See the Write() function description.
101 PCI read-modify-write services. See the Modify() function description.
